Introduction:
Opening a spa is an exciting venture that allows you to create a tranquil oasis where clients can relax, rejuvenate, and pamper themselves. As you embark on this journey, there are essential steps to consider to ensure the success of your spa business. From designing a serene environment to offering a range of luxurious treatments, each aspect plays a crucial role in attracting clientele and establishing a reputable spa brand. Let’s delve into the key points to consider when opening a spa and setting the foundation for a thriving wellness establishment.

Key Points:
1. Crafting a Relaxing Atmosphere: Creating a serene and inviting ambiance is paramount for a spa. The physical space of your spa should evoke a sense of tranquility and luxury, with soothing colors, soft lighting, and comfortable furnishings that promote relaxation. Incorporating natural elements such as plants and water features can enhance the calming environment, offering clients a peaceful retreat from their daily stressors. Maintaining cleanliness and organization is essential to ensuring a hygienic and welcoming atmosphere for clients. A well-kept spa not only enhances the overall experience but also reflects professionalism and attention to detail, instilling trust and confidence in your services.

2. Curating a Diverse Menu of Treatments: A diverse selection of spa treatments is fundamental in catering to a wide range of client preferences and needs. Consider offering various massages, facials, body scrubs, and skincare treatments to address different wellness concerns and provide customized experiences. Collaborating with skilled therapists and estheticians ensures quality services that deliver results and leave clients feeling pampered and rejuvenated. Promoting specialty treatments or packages that focus on specific wellness goals, such as stress relief, anti-aging, or detoxification, can attract clients seeking targeted solutions and personalized care. Highlighting the unique benefits of each treatment helps clients make informed choices and enhances their spa experience.

3. Staffing Qualified Professionals: The expertise and professionalism of your spa staff play a significant role in delivering exceptional service and building client trust. Hiring skilled therapists, estheticians, and massage practitioners with relevant certifications and experience ensures the quality and effectiveness of your spa treatments. Providing ongoing training and professional development opportunities for your team enhances their skills and knowledge, enabling them to deliver top-notch services and exceed client expectations. Fostering a culture of hospitality and compassion among your staff encourages positive interactions with clients and creates a welcoming environment. Empathy, attentiveness, and excellent communication skills are essential qualities that contribute to a memorable spa experience and foster long-lasting client relationships.

4. Implementing Effective Marketing Strategies: Effective marketing is key to attracting new clients, building brand awareness, and generating revenue for your spa business. Utilize digital marketing tools such as social media, email campaigns, and a professional website to showcase your spa services, special offers, and client testimonials. Engaging content, stunning visuals, and clear calls-to-action can entice potential clients and drive them to book appointments at your spa. Collaborating with local businesses, partnering with influencers, and hosting promotional events can help expand your spa’s reach and attract a diverse clientele. Offering introductory discounts, loyalty programs, or referral incentives can incentivize repeat visits and encourage client loyalty, contributing to the long-term success of your spa.

5. Ensuring Regulatory Compliance and Safety: Compliance with industry regulations and safety standards is crucial to maintaining the integrity and reputation of your spa business. Obtain the necessary licenses and permits required to operate a spa in your locality, ensuring that your facility meets health, sanitation, and safety guidelines. Implement strict hygiene protocols, sanitation practices, and sterilization procedures to protect the health and well-being of your clients and staff. Regular inspections, maintenance checks, and staff training on safety protocols and emergency procedures are essential in ensuring a safe and secure spa environment. Prioritizing the health and safety of everyone in your spa demonstrates your commitment to professionalism and quality service, earning the trust and loyalty of your clients.

Conclusion:
In conclusion, opening a spa requires careful planning, attention to detail, and a commitment to excellence in service delivery. By focusing on creating a tranquil atmosphere, offering a diverse menu of treatments, staffing qualified professionals, implementing effective marketing strategies, and ensuring regulatory compliance and safety, you can lay a solid foundation for a successful spa business. Embrace the opportunity to provide clients with a rejuvenating sanctuary where they can unwind, refresh, and experience the benefits of holistic wellness. With dedication, passion, and a client-centric approach, your spa has the potential to thrive and become a sought-after destination for relaxation and rejuvenation.
